andre 2 лет назад
Родитель
Сommit
c1bd20bdbe
1 измененных файлов с 7 добавлено и 24 удалено
  1. 7 24
      app/UI/Client/EmailAlias/Providers/DeleteEmailAliasDataProvider.php

+ 7 - 24
app/UI/Client/EmailAlias/Providers/DeleteEmailAliasDataProvider.php

@@ -64,20 +64,11 @@ class DeleteEmailAliasDataProvider extends BaseDataProvider
             );
             return ['error' => $error->getMessage()];
         }
-
-        logModuleCall(
-            'kerioEmail',
-            __FUNCTION__,
-            $this->formData['id'],
-            'Debug Error',
-            $result
-        );
         $api->logout();
 
         $productManager = new ProductManager();
         $productManager->loadByHostingId($hid);
 
-
         return (new HtmlDataJsonResponse())->setMessageAndTranslate('emailAliasHasBeenDeleted')->setStatusSuccess();
     }
 
@@ -94,23 +85,15 @@ class DeleteEmailAliasDataProvider extends BaseDataProvider
         $productManager = new ProductManager();
         $productManager->loadByHostingId($hid);
 
-        /**
-         *
-         * get soap create alias service
-         * set service configuration
-         */
-        $service = (new KerioManager())
-            ->getApiByHosting($hid)
-            ->soap
-            ->service()
-            ->deleteAccountAlias();
-
         foreach ($this->request->get('massActions') as $endodedData)
         {
-            $data = json_decode(base64_decode($endodedData), true);
-            $data['id'] = $data['accId'];
-            $service->setFormData($data);
-            $result = $service->run();
+            logModuleCall(
+                'kerioEmail',
+                __FUNCTION__,
+                $endodedData,
+                'Debug Error',
+                ''
+            );
         }
 
         return (new HtmlDataJsonResponse())->setMessageAndTranslate('massEmailAliasHasBeenDeleted')->setStatusSuccess();